Salted Caramel Snickerdoodle Cheesecake Bars Delight You!


  • Author: Sophie
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 12 bars 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Delicious salted caramel snickerdoodle cheesecake bars that combine the flavors of snickerdoodle cookies and creamy cheesecake, topped with a rich salted caramel sauce.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on cream of tartar
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 1/4 cup salted caramel sauce
  • Extra caramel sauce for drizzling

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a baking dish.
  2. In a bowl, cream together the but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
  3. Add the egg and vanilla extract, mixing until well combined.
  4. In another bowl, whisk together the flour, cream of tartar, baking soda, salt, and cinnamon.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
  6. Press half of the dough into the bottom of the prepared baking dish.
  7. In a separate bowl, beat the c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th.
  8. Spread the cream cheese mixture over the pressed dough in the baking dish.
  9. Drop spoonfuls of the remaining dough over the cream cheese layer.
  10.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the top is golden brown.
  11. Allow to cool, then drizzle with salted caramel sauce before serving.

Notes

  • For a richer flavor, use dark brown sugar instead of light brown sugar.
  • Make sure the cream cheese is at room temperature for easier mixing.
  •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
